WebThe Marianne North Gallery at Kew Gardens first opened in 1882 and was fully refurbished and restored in 2010. The gallery houses the only permanent solo exhibition by a female artist in Britain. Marianne North was a remarkable Victorian artist who travelled the globe to satisfy her passion for recording the world’s flora with her paintbrush. WebOctober 24, 1830 Women in Exploration Marianne North was a biologist, botanical illustrator and the only female artist in Britain to have a permanent exhibition at Kew Gardens. In a span of 20 years, North traveled throughout various parts of the world and painted rare plant specimens. comptabiliser solde is

Web9 nov. 2024 · The Marianne North Gallery showcases paintings by the Victorian artist and explorer Marianne North, made during her travels to fifteen countries in fourteen years (1871-1885) documenting the flora and culture of Europe, Asia and the Americas. WebRoyal Botanical Gardens, Kew, opened The Marianne North Gallery in 1882. It houses over 800 paintings by the incredible artist Marianne North, who travelled the world solo to paint plants and flowers in their natural habitats.
